Publication number: 20250143398Abstract: A hard hat with symmetric front and back mounting ridges to support a headlamp is described. The hard hat provides mounting ridges to receive insertion slots of a rigid mounting bracket that fit around the ridges. The rigid mounting bracket includes channels to loop a strap through the channels and support a lamp on the bracket. The strap may include a hook and loop fastener system to enable attachment of a variety of lamps to the rigid support bracket. In this way, the hard hat can support a wide variety of headlamps attached to the rigid mounting bracket without destructive alterations to the hard hat. Publication number: 20250108488Abstract: A hand tool includes a first jaw, a first handle fixed to the first jaw, a second jaw, and a second handle pivotally coupled to the second jaw, a link member, and an adjustment member. The adjustment member is operable to axially move a first end of the link member to vary a distance between the first and second jaws. The adjustment member includes an engagement surface engageable with the first end of the link member, a shank in threaded engagement with a bore in the first handle, and a flange extending from the shank opposite the engagement portion. Patent number: 12257693Abstract: A storage case includes a base including a lower surface, walls extending from the lower surface, and a plurality of recesses arranged in a grid adjacent the lower surface. The lower surface and the walls define a cavity, and each recess has a double bayonet shape defining a partially circular shape with a pair of bayonet channels. The storage case further includes a peg positioned within the cavity and having an elongated body configured to support a tool accessory. The elongated body has a first end and a second end opposite the first end, and the first end includes a bayonet projection. Patent number: 12186928Abstract: A cutter, such as a tubing cutter or a swing cutter. The cutter includes a cutting wheel; a roller; a housing assembly including a first housing portion supporting the cutting wheel and a second housing portion supporting the roller; a shaft connecting the housing portions, rotation of the shaft causing relative movement of the housing portions along a shaft axis; and a knob connected to the shaft and engageable by a user to rotate the shaft, the knob having, in a plane perpendicular to the shaft axis, a non-symmetrical shape defined by opposite circular sector portions and opposite lever portions, each lever portion being engageable by a user to apply a force to the knob in a direction of rotation. Publication number: 20240306753Abstract: A hard hat attachment system is described with front, back, and side mounts to support various accessories. Mounts of hard hat receive slots of a bracket that fit around the ridges. Auxiliary ridges receive clips within ports. The user customizes the hard hat for the particular task with the preferred accessories used to complete the job. For example, lamps, face-shields, reflectors, tool carriers, and eyeglass holders are interchangeably releasably coupled to mounting and/or auxiliary ridges on the hard hat. In this way, the hard hat is customized and/or modified to support a wide variety of accessories that are securely and releasably attached to mounting and/or auxiliary ridges without destructive alterations to the hard hat.
